Smartphone Buying Guide for Beginners (2025 Edition)

Are you planning to buy a new smartphone in 2025 but feel overwhelmed by terms like AMOLED, 5G, or RAM? Don’t worry — you’re not alone. This guide breaks down the most important things to look for so you can make a smart, confident decision.

1. Set Your Budget

Decide how much you’re ready to spend. There are great phones under ₹16,000 with premium features.

2. Display Quality

Look for AMOLED displays if you want better colors and contrast. A 90Hz or 120Hz refresh rate makes scrolling smoother.

3. Processor & Performance

Choose phones with Snapdragon or MediaTek Dimensity processors. They’re fast and energy efficient — good for gaming, apps, and multitasking.

4. Battery Life

Go for phones with at least 5000mAh batteries. Also, fast charging (33W or higher) is a bonus.

5. Camera Quality

Megapixels aren’t everything. Look for AI features, night mode, and image stabilization for better results.

6. 5G Connectivity

If 5G is available in your area, buy a 5G-ready phone for better internet speed and future-proofing.

7. Software Experience

Brands like Samsung (One UI), Xiaomi (MIUI), and Realme (Realme UI) offer different experiences — choose the one you're comfortable with.

Final Tip:

Always compare 2–3 models before you decide. And don’t just rely on ads — read real user reviews and blog posts.

Top 5 Budget Smartphones in 2025: Great Features at Low Prices

Top 5 Budget Smartphones in 2025 Under $200

Are you looking for a powerful smartphone that fits your budget in 2025? Good news — you don’t have to spend a fortune to get great features like AMOLED displays, 5G connectivity, and long-lasting batteries.

Here are the top 5 budget smartphones you should consider this year:

1. Redmi Note 14

  • Price: Around $180
  • Highlights: Snapdragon 6 Gen 1, 120Hz AMOLED, 5000mAh battery
  • Why it’s great: Excellent performance and camera for the price.

2. Realme Narzo 70 Pro 5G

  • Price: Around $200
  • Highlights: Dimensity 7050, 67W fast charging, AI camera features
  • Why it’s great: Great value with solid build and camera.

3. Samsung Galaxy M14 5G

  • Price: Around $170
  • Highlights: Exynos 1330, 6000mAh battery, OneUI experience
  • Why it’s great: Trusted brand and great battery life.

4. Poco X5

  • Price: Around $190
  • Highlights: Snapdragon 695, 120Hz AMOLED, 48MP camera
  • Why it’s great: Stylish design and smooth performance.

5. Infinix Zero 5G 2025

  • Price: Around $150
  • Highlights: Dimensity 920, 5G, 5000mAh battery
  • Why it’s great: One of the cheapest 5G phones with reliable features.

Final Thoughts:

These smartphones prove that budget doesn't mean boring anymore. Pick one based on what matters most — camera, battery, or performance — and enjoy flagship-like features without spending a fortune.
